Savannah-Mr. Robert Lamont McSpadden , 72, died on Wednesday, April 23 in the care of the Hospice House Savannah. Robert was born in Hoboken, GA and lived most of his life in Savannah. He was an avid golfer, fisherman and a huge Sand Gnats fan. Mr. McSpadden was also a long time member of the Savannah Moose Lodge #1550.
Survivors include his daughter, Jennifer McSpadden Privette, son-in-law, Kenny Privette of Pooler, grandsons, Jensen and Hayden Privette, two sons, Michael (Sharon) McSpadden of Guyton and Rocky (Christina) McSpadden of Atlanta, one sister, Delona McSpadden, one brother, James (Annette) McSpadden, both of Brunswick, GA, 10 grandchildren, 6 great grandchildren, several nieces, nephews and many adopted children and grandchildren along the way.
Visitation will be on Friday, April 25 from 4 p.m. to 8 p.m. at Thomas C. Strickland and Sons Funeral Home in Pooler and the service honoring his life will be held on Saturday, April 26, 2008 at 11 a.m. at the Thomas C. Strickland and Sons Funeral Home, West Chatham Chapel.
